How To Make Leek, Cheddar & Bacon Loaf Sandwich

Preparation: 15 minutes
Cooking: 30 minutes
Total: 45 minutes

Serves:

Ingredients

  • 1 loaf of bread
  • 4 slices of cheddar cheese
  • 8 slices of cooked bacon
  • 1 leek, thinly sliced
  • 2 tablespoons of butter
  • 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).

  2. Cut the top off the loaf of bread and remove some of the inside to create a hollow cavity.

  3. In a pan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the leeks,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Cook until the leeks are soft and slightly caramelized.

  4. Fill the cavity of the loaf with the cooked leeks.

  5. Layer the cheddar cheese and bacon on top of the leeks.

  6. Place the top of the loaf back on and wrap the entire loaf in aluminum foil.

  7.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and the bread is toasted.

  8. Slice the loaf into individual sandwiches and serve hot.

Nutrition

  • Calories : 420kcal
  • Total Fat : 17g
  • Saturated Fat : 9g
  • Cholesterol : 53mg
  • Sodium : 776mg
  • Total Carbohydrates : 45g
  • Dietary Fiber : 3g
  • Sugar : 2g
  • Protein : 24g
